Defending champion Rob Fowler remains alive and kicking at the Safeway men's provincial curling championship in Neepawa.

In Draw 11, Fowler and David Kraichy of Fort Rouge held a close match until the very end. Kraichy started off strong with a 4-2 lead after five ends. Fowler and Kraichy then traded deuces back and forth. Fowler would score one in the eighth and stole a deuce in the ninth to make the score 7-6 for Fowler.

Kraichy tied it up in the 10th end but a draw to the eight foot for a single was successful for Fowler in the 11th to claim the victory.

Fowler, Scott Ramsay of Granite, Steen Sigurdson of Fort Rouge, and Dennis Bohn of Assiniboine Memorial all advance to the playoff round beginning at 7:45 p.m.
